americanthinker/rag-applications

RAG applications repo for Uplimit course

40
/ 100
Emerging

This project helps experienced Python developers and search engine professionals learn to build advanced Retrieval Augmented Generation (RAG) applications. It takes raw text data, processes it, embeds it, and then uses a large language model (LLM) to answer questions based on the retrieved information, outputting a complete, demo-ready RAG system with a user interface. This is for developers or engineers who want to integrate sophisticated search and AI-driven question answering into their systems.

No commits in the last 6 months.

Use this if you are a Python developer with experience in search engines and want to learn how to architect and implement a full RAG application.

Not ideal if you are looking for a plug-and-play RAG solution to use directly, or if you do not have strong Python coding and search engine experience.

AI-application-development search-engineering natural-language-processing machine-learning-engineering information-retrieval
No License Stale 6m No Package No Dependents
Maintenance 2 / 25
Adoption 5 / 25
Maturity 8 / 25
Community 25 / 25

How are scores calculated?

Stars

9

Forks

125

Language

Python

License

Last pushed

Jul 20, 2025

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/rag/americanthinker/rag-applications"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.